Drinking well in its youth, the 2021 vintage (4*) was fully fermented in seasoned oak barrels. Pale gold, it is weighty, with good concentration of peachy, spicy flavours, a vague hint of honey, fresh acidity and an off-dry (7.5 grams/litre of residual sugar) finish.
